Dr. Andi Asrifan is a leading voice in early childhood education and instructional technology, whose work bridges cognitive development theory with cutting-edge digital pedagogy. His most influential contribution, the chapter "Tech-Enhanced Early Learning" (2024), offers a comprehensive synthesis of how persuasive educational technologies can be strategically integrated into early childhood settings. Drawing on foundational cognitive development principles, Asrifan critically examines the theoretical frameworks that make digital tools effective for young learners, moving beyond simple screen-time debates to articulate how technology can genuinely enhance foundational literacy, numeracy, and social skills. This work has quickly garnered attention within the field, accumulating 2 citations in its first year and establishing him as a key researcher shaping the conversation around developmentally appropriate technology use. His research provides essential guidance for educators and policymakers navigating the complex intersection of digital innovation and early learning, ensuring that technological integration is both pedagogically sound and ethically grounded. Asrifan’s scholarship continues to influence how we understand the potential—and the limits—of technology in shaping the minds of the next generation.
